4.3 Hazardous wastes (as per Hazardous Waste Management Rules) Yes During Construction phase: Used oil whenever generated from the DG sets is being kept in leak proof containers in an isolated area and same is being sent to approved recycler. Same shall be followed for proposed expansion also. During Operation Phase: After expansion, 80 Lt/month of Used oil will be generated from diesel generators which will be carefully stored in HDPE drums in isolated covered facility. 4.6 Sewage sludge or other sludge from effluent treatment Yes After expansion, about 143 Kg/day of dried sludge will be generated from STP within complex during operation phase. The wet sludge will be passed through filter press where it will be dewatered/ dried to form a cake and then will be used as manure in green areas. The unused sludge shall be given to farmers or nursery.

7.1 From handling, storage, use or spillage of hazardous materials Yes After expansion, the hazardous waste generated will be Used oil only and it will be stored in HDPE drums and kept in covered rooms under lock and key and will be sold to authorized vendors of CPCB only. Special care will be taken to prevent leakages and spills.
7.2 From discharge of sewage or other effluents to water or the land (expected mode and place of discharge) Yes After expansion, during operational phase, STP of total capacity 2600 KLD (2 STP’s of 1150 KLD & 1 STP of 300 KLD) will be installed for the treatment of waste water & the treated water of 1191 KLD will be used in flushing, Gardening, D.G cooling & HVAC cooling & Miscellaneous purposes. Excess treated water of 581 KLD will be discharged to sewer line as per discharge standard.
